Les Bali et Les Peuplades Apparentées (Ndaka-Mbo-Beke-Lika-Budu-Nyari)

Summary

Routledge is proud to be re-issuing this landmark series in association with the International African Institute. The series, published between 1950 and 1977, brings together a wealth of previously un-co-ordinated material on the ethnic groupings and social conditions of African peoples.
Concise, critical and (for its time) accurate, the Ethnographic Survey contains sections as follows:


  • Physical Environment

  • Linguistic Data

  • Demography

  • History & Traditions of Origin

  • Nomenclature

  • Grouping

  • Cultural Features: Religion, Witchcraft, Birth, Initiation, Burial

  • Social & Political Organization: Kinship, Marriage, Inheritance, Slavery, Land Tenure, Warfare & Justice

  • Economy & Trade

  • Domestic Architecture
Each of the 50 volumes will be available to buy individually, and these are organized into regional sub-groups: East Central Africa, North-Eastern Africa, Southern Africa, West Central Africa, Western Africa, and Central Africa Belgian Congo.
The volumes are supplemented with maps, available to view on routledge.com or available as a pdf from the publishers.
